What is a Wall Chaser?


A wall chaser, or wall groove cutting machine, is a power tool developed to produce narrow grooves in masonry walls. It is usually utilized to go after out materials like concrete, brick, or mortar to permit the setup of electrical channel, tubing, or other needs. These tools are geared up with two parallel diamond blades that enable for precise cutting and very little material loss.

Advantages of Using a Wall Chaser with a Vacuum Cleaner

Using a wall chaser without a vacuum can lead to clouds of dust and particles that can disrupt the workplace, cause health problems, and develop a cleaning headache afterward. By integrating a wall chaser with a vacuum, users can delight in a number of benefits:

  1. Cleaner Work Environment: Dust and debris are immediately gathered, keeping the work space neat and arranged.
  2. Healthier Air Quality: Minimizing the dispersion of fine dust particles assists in preserving better air quality, reducing breathing risks.
  3. Improved Visibility: A cleaner office enables much better exposure and precision during work.
  4. Effectiveness in Cleanup: With minimal debris spread around, the cleanup process becomes much less lengthy.

How to Use a Wall Chaser with a Vacuum Cleaner

Using a wall chaser with a vacuum cleaner is a straightforward procedure, but it needs some preparatory steps and appropriate methods. Here's a simple guide to utilizing this powerful combination effectively.

Step-by-Step Process

Step

Description

1. Select the Right Tools

Select a wall chaser that suits your intended use, and guarantee your vacuum has sufficient suction power.

2. Prepare the Area

Clear the work area of any unnecessary products. If required, use drop cloths to secure close-by surfaces.

3. Mark the Groove Path

Determine and mark the course of the groove with a pencil. Utilize a level for precision.

4. Link the Vacuum

Attach the proper pipe from the vacuum to the wall chaser. Check the connection to ensure correct suction.

5. Set the Depth

Change the blade depth on the wall chaser according to your requirements.

6. Start Cutting

Switch on the vacuum, followed by the wall chaser, and carefully maneuver along the significant path.

7. Monitor for Blockages

Regularly check the vacuum hose for blockages and make sure suction remains reliable.

8. Complete the Job

As soon as completed, inspect to see if the groove is deep and broad enough for your installation requires.

Tips for Effective Use


To get the best outcomes when utilizing a wall chaser with a vacuum, consider the following ideas:

  1. Use Quality Blades: Invest in top quality diamond blades to make sure smooth cuts and longer tool life.
  2. Maintain a Steady Hand: A steady grip guarantees directly, precise cuts and avoids unexpected damage to the wall.
  3. Operate in Sections: Break down longer cuts into areas if essential to preserve accuracy and prevent burnout.
  4. Use Protective Gear: Always use security goggles, a dust mask, and ear security when running power tools.
  5. Practice: If you're inexperienced, practice on scrap material to get a feel for the tool before you begin on the actual wall.
